Lai’s visit to the U.S. helps burnish his credentials in the lead-up to Taiwan’s January presidential election.

Taiwan’s vice president Lai Ching-te defied pressure from Beijing to make a transit stop in New York City on Saturday en route to a state visit to Paraguay.
